Work History

Water Maintenance Worker

1 Year 9 Months
City of Bothell | 12.2024 - Current

* Assisted in monitoring municipal water quality through daily chlorine residual testing and system flushing to ensure compliance with state and federal drinking water standards. * Completed work orders, maintenance records, and operational documentation accurately and on time. * Performed citywide water meter reading and verification to support accurate utility billing and account management; assisted with the valve maintenance program by locating, exercising, and documenting valve conditions throughout the distribution system. * Responded to customer service requests by diagnosing and resolving issues within the municipal water distribution system. * Performed emergency maintenance and repairs on water mains, service lines, fire hydrants, and valves, restoring service safely and in accordance with department procedures. * Performed hydro excavation and trench shoring in compliance with OSHA standards and departmental procedures. * Established and maintained traffic control zones to protect workers and the public during utility maintenance and emergency response operations. * Collaborated with crew members, supervisors, and contractors to complete routine maintenance and emergency projects safely and efficiently.

Seasonal Water/Sewer Maintenance Worker

4 Months
City of Bothell | 07.2024 - 11.2024

* Worked collaboratively with Public Works crews to locate and repair damaged water service lines and address hazardous infrastructure, including displaced or damaged manhole lids, to ensure public safety. * Loaded and unloaded vehicles with tools, equipment, and materials for maintenance and utility projects, ensuring readiness for daily operations. * Assisted with the operation of a Vactor truck to clean and rod sewer lines, exercised water distribution valves, and collected chlorine residual samples to support system maintenance and water quality. * Assisted with asphalt restoration by placing and compacting asphalt using vibratory plate compactor and applying sealant, contributing to safe and effective roadway repairs. * Assisted in establishing temporary traffic control zones, including the placement of signs, cones, and barricades, and performed flagging duties in accordance with traffic control and safety standards. * Maintained city-owned properties through mowing, hedge trimming, weed control, debris removal, and general grounds upkeep, enhancing community aesthetics and safety.
